Police: Armed Robber Strikes Greenwich Gas Station On Route 1

GREENWICH, Conn. -- The attendant at the Sheep Hill Mobil Gas Station on Route 1 in Greenwich was robbed at gunpoint by a lone male suspect wearing a mask early Saturday, police said. 

At 1:30 a.m., the suspect entered the gas station at 1129 E. Putnam Ave., brandishing a handgun and demanding cash, said Lt. Kraig Gray, public information officer. 

The attendant, who was not injured, immediately complied with the demands, Gray said, and the suspect fled the store with a small amount of cash.  

The suspect got into a waiting vehicle, described as possibly an older model gold-colored SUV, and fled the area, he said.

The suspect was described as a male with a light complexion, unknown age, and of average height with average build, Gray said.  

The suspect was also wearing  a plastic semi-opaque Halloween mask and sunglasses, a dark hoodie sweatshirt, brown jacket, dark colored pants and white sneakers, he said.

Anyone with any information about the armed robbery is asked to contact the Greenwich Police Tip Line at 203-622-3333 or 1-800-372-1176 or by email at tips@greenwichct.org.
